47 "n", ///< frame number (starting at zero)
48 "nb_channels", ///< number of channels
49 "nb_consumed_samples", ///< number of samples consumed by the filter
50 "nb_samples", ///< number of samples in the current frame
51 "pos", ///< position in the file of the frame
52 "pts", ///< frame presentation timestamp
53 "sample_rate", ///< sample rate
54 "startpts", ///< PTS at start of stream
55 "startt", ///< time at start of stream
56 "t", ///< time in the file of the frame
57 "tb", ///< timebase
58 "volume", ///< last set value
